Hi all
Just wanted to know whether the lights on a e60 2007 onwards uplift model would fit on a 2006 e60?
Preferably xenon the LCC kit?
Thanks

its not plug and play. connections are different, has the 2006 xenon's ?
If the 2006 e60 is post september 2006 it has already the LM2 lightmodule which makes things easier.
But plug and play it never is.
I did a full OEM retrofit using BMW instructions on mine from pre-LCI halogen to LCI xenon (front and rear) with all the sensors. Its a huge task, taking 2 to 3 days. Retrofittting the headlamp washers I still have to do. Mine had already the LM2 modules so that makes things easier coding wise.
However if you don't care for OEM there are other possibilities.
